    I'm not even sure how much of it is Disney's fault. Granted I don't know much about business, but LucasFilm still exists as an entity with Kathleen Kennedy in control. It's not like Disney is going to micromanage every last thing that LFL does. It's Kennedy and Lucas that are meeting with Abrams about Episode VII, etc. Not Bob Iger.

    Kennedy has accountability to Disney for the financial success of LFL, but I don't think Iger is looking over her shoulder in everything she does. She might be the one responsible, or maybe "Disney" is as people assume, or maybe Lucas wanted it to wrap up without his further involvement. Who knows? I can't point the finger because I don't even know if TCW is ending, but if it is, I still wouldn't know enough about the infrastructure of the corporations to know who has the authority to pull the plug, and who actually did. It could simply be something like actors being released from their contracts and not wanting to come back. If that were the case for enough of them, they perhaps threw in the towel. I mean shows like Futurama and Simpsons are sometimes in limbo over the cast returning/not returning. It's not like they would recast Homer, Marge, Bart, or Lisa. If Matt Lanter and Dee Baker decided "you know what, I don't want to do this show anymore" would it go on? They are by no means obligated to do it if their contracts expire.

    Still, if it comes down to immediate cancellation or dragging the show out til 2015 or beyond, I choose cancellation. But ideally, I would have given it another season, even if it's just a limited half season. There aren't that many loose ends. Maul, Rex, Asajj, and Talzin can all be wrapped up. As for Ahsoka's "ultimate fate," why does it have to be any more "ultimate" than just walking away from the Jedi Order?

    The main Disney Channel focuses on teen shows after 1 pm till sometime over night. From about 6 am I think till 1 pm they focus on the Disney Jr. shows like Mickey Mouse Clubhouse and Little Enstiens. So for the most part if you are not a pre-teen girl or a preschooler there isn't a lot on Disney Channel for you. Now if you spend the money and get Disney XD and some of the other premium Disney channels they show old school X-Men and Spider-man shows among some older favorites like Darkwing Duck. Which if Disney does pick up Clone Wars it will likely go on Disney XD or put onto ABC's Saturday Morning line up. Disney XD presents a problem because it means a lot of fans buying an extra service that they probably won't. They'll just wait for the DVD's to come out. The logical route would be to go with ABC Saturday Morning which would also open it up to more people who may not have access to Cartoon Network or don't normally watch it.
